Actually, I have found that only someone who is truely new to computers is offended by it.
A lot of games people will play and say something like, "Hey, I'm a noob here, what do I do?" "Arg, I can't figure this out. I"m a newbie. What do I do?" "Help! I"m a newb!"
Everyone is a "noob" "newb" "newbie" to every game at one point. It is just something you have to accept. When someone refers to someone as a noob, it no longer has the conintations that it orginaly had in the early days of the internet. In the early days a noob was someone who didn't know anything about computers. Now everyone does, and a noob is just someone who is new to the game/program/etc...
